Antibiotic-associated C. difficile colitis in a 3-year-old. First-line treatment?

Educational content. Not a substitute for clinical judgement or local policy.

Reveal the answer and explanation

Correct answer: EOral metronidazole

Non-severe CDI: oral metronidazole first-line. Oral vancomycin for severe/recurrent.
